微信小程序点餐系统实现与设计

版权申诉
5星 · 超过95%的资源 91 下载量 140 浏览量 更新于2024-11-07 22 收藏 246.86MB RAR 举报
资源摘要信息: "本项目是一个微信小程序形式的点餐系统,涵盖了从用户界面设计到后端功能实现的多个关键部分。微信小程序,作为近年来流行的轻应用平台,允许开发者在微信生态系统内快速创建和部署应用程序。点餐系统,作为一种典型的电子商务应用,使得用户能够通过手机快速完成餐厅食品的选购和下单。" 知识点概述: 1. 微信小程序开发基础 微信小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的梦想,用户扫一扫或搜一下即可打开应用。小程序主要由四个文件组成:JSON 配置文件、WXML 模板文件、WXSS 样式文件和 JS 脚本逻辑文件。 2. 底部标签导航的设计 在微信小程序中,底部标签导航是用户快速切换页面的重要功能,通常用于切换小程序的主功能模块。设计时需注意保持图标和文字的直观性和一致性,确保用户能够轻松识别并进行操作。 3. 幻灯片轮播效果设计 幻灯片轮播效果常用于展示商品或活动的图片和信息,以吸引用户注意。实现该功能需要利用小程序提供的API进行图片资源的轮播控制,同时应考虑到用户的交互体验,如自定义轮播速度、动画效果等。 4. 菜单列表效果显示 菜单列表是点餐系统的核心功能之一,需要清晰展示各菜品的名称、价格、图片等信息。在设计上,应提供良好的可读性和操作便捷性,例如使用卡片布局和列表视图组件。 5. 购物车功能实现 购物车功能允许用户在选购商品后暂时存储,以便进行结账。在技术实现上,需要对用户选择的商品进行数据管理,并提供添加、删除、修改商品数量等操作。 6. 订单详情页面设计 订单详情页面需要展示用户所选商品的完整信息,包括菜品图片、名称、数量、价格、总价等,并且需要提供订单状态、支付方式、联系方式等信息的填写区域。 7. 订单列表设计 订单列表用于展示用户的订单历史,应包括订单时间、订单号、订单状态、消费金额等关键信息,并提供查看详细订单的功能。 8. 消费记录页面的设计 消费记录页面用于让用户查看历史消费记录,包括消费时间、消费金额、消费详情等,通常会有筛选和统计功能,帮助用户更好地管理自己的消费情况。 9. 微信小程序界面UI设计 微信小程序的界面设计应遵循微信官方的设计规范,包括色彩、字体、图标、按钮等视觉元素的设计原则,以确保良好的用户体验。 10. 微信小程序前端技术 包括小程序的框架、组件、API的使用,以及对WXML、WXSS、JavaScript的掌握,实现与用户的交互逻辑。 11. 微信小程序后端服务 后端服务通常涉及服务器、数据库、API接口设计和维护,保证前端数据的正常流转和业务逻辑的实现。 12. 微信支付集成 为了完成订单的支付,微信点餐系统需要集成微信支付功能,这需要了解微信支付的接入流程和安全保障措施。 以上知识点,涵盖了微信点餐系统小程序项目的设计与开发的全貌,从界面设计、功能实现到后端服务和支付集成,每一个环节都是整个系统不可或缺的部分。开发者在进行此类项目时,需要综合运用各种技术知识,才能开发出一个既符合用户需求又具有良好性能的点餐系统。